FEATURED WORK Description: The Symbicort brand team faced an uphill battle. Most providers believed that when it came to COPD treatment, many of the therapeutic options they have are about the same. The campaign needed to quickly and immediately demonstrate that Symbicort is different. Insights discovered from carefully listening to providers showed if Symbicort were given to patients during a doctor's visit, patients start feeling better before they leave the office. The brand team used what they discovered to create a campaign that clearly communicates Symbicort's fast and sustainable difference. Why This Campaign Is Special: One of the goals of the campaign was to demonstrate how Symbicort is distinct from its competitors. The creative team tackled the challenge by designing "tachometer lungs" to quickly visualize speed and combining the visual with a verb often tied to engine speed, "rev." The result was a campaign that helped Symbicort outperform its competitors, including the market leader.

FEATURED WORK

Description: Celgene retained Arteric to enhance Celgene's global brand equity and influence by consolidating its portfolio of localized regional corporate web sites under a single technology framework and design language. The framework reduces costs and accelerates the distribution of key corporate messages globally in multiple languages and legal/regulatory contexts.

Account Team/Development Team: Hans Kaspersetz (President), Sean Carr (Account), Leslie Kramer (Engagement Manager), Reavens Fenelon (Developer), Lloyd McGarrigal (Developer), Anthony Outeiral (Developer), Oleg Plysyk (Developer), Isaac Myman (Quality Assurance)

Why is your sample ad special?: The global framework enables Celgene to launch new country web sites rapidly by translating the master web site using 3rd party integrations and a bespoke content workflow that facilitates collaboration by disparate global internal stakeholders. It features a library of technologies and assets that are configured for each region and its legal/ regulatory requirements.
